Cox Chulavista

be the first one to review!

53-99 E Flower St
Chula Vista CA, 91910

open 24 hours


53-99 E Flower St, Chula Vista CA, 91910
(877)866-9384



Looking For Cable Companies?


About Cox Chulavista

We are local authorized dealer for the company.

Payment Options: Visa, Master Card, American Express, Discover, Debit Card, PayPal

Map To This Location



Receive Offers From

Cox Chulavista
You will receive updates from Cox Chulavista
Copyright © 2006-2024 SHOWMELOCAL Inc. - All Rights Reserved. | Made in NYC
SHOWMELOCAL®.com is Your Yellow Pages and Local Business Directory Network
SHOWMELOCAL® is a registered trademark of ShowMeLocal Inc.




Top